Business Development Specialist

Remote Full-time
Cintas is a publicly held Fortune 500 company that provides products and services to help businesses maintain clean and safe facilities. The Business Development Specialist will focus on promoting products to customers, ensuring growth through sales calls, and collaborating with sales teams to meet customer needs. Responsibilities Promote our products to new and existing customers through outbound phone calls within an assigned portfolio to ensure year over year growth Understanding the customer’s objectives and positioning Design Collective as the apparel partner of choice Collaboration with field sales to ensure customers understand all available solutions Working cross functionally to ensure timely project completion Leading professional virtual presentations Educating customers about our online ordering platform Collecting/managing data through our contact management system May also become a subject matter expert for the department Run process improvement projects Visit local properties as necessary Skills Previous Sales experience Previous experience successfully meeting sales and performance goals Proficiency with Microsoft Office including,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ook and Internet/Intranet required Ability to travel up to 10% High School Diploma/GED 1+ year of previous Inside Sales experience Bachelor's Degree Benefits Comprehensive and competitive medical, dental and vision benefits, with premiums below the national average. Flexibility with four different medical plan options; one plan is offered at zero cost. Competitive Pay 401(k) with Company Match/Profit Sharing/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P) Disability, Life and AD&D Insurance, 100% Company Paid Paid Time Off and Holidays Skills Development, Training and Career Advancement Opportunities Company Overview Cintas is a facilities services company that provides uniforms, mats, mops, towels, restroom supplies, first aid, and safety products. It was founded in 1968, and is headquartered in Mason, Ohio, USA, with a workforce of 10001+ employees. Its website is
